ex·ploit1

exploit1

pronunciation:
ek sploIt
part of speech: noun
definition: a deed of daring or spirit; feat.
This book is about the exploits of the early explorers of the Antarctic.He was tired of hearing about the exploits of his older brother, so he went off to join the Marines.
 
synonyms:
achievement, deed, feat
similar words:
act, action, escapade, maneuver, stunt, trick, venture
